Drop bad speech frames rather than forwarding them via RTP
Some RTP endpoints may not check for bad frame indications, so a frame that is marked as bad may be still forwarded, which creates anoying noise. This patch drops these frames. It depends on the other RTP endpoint how dropped frames are handled. (insert silence, extrapolate speech...)
